While the majority of Studio Ghibli’s films are directed by Miyazaki Hayao and Takahata Isao, there have been exceptions over the years, including the 2002 feature The Cat Returns. Directed by Morita Hiroyuki who was previously a key animator on My Neighbors the Yamadas, The Cat Returns is a follow-up to late director Kondo Yoshifume’s 1995 Ghibli feature Whisper of the Heart. In Whisper of the Heart, the young protagonist and aspiring writer toiled over a fantasy story about a schoolgirl and a dapper feline named Baron. Seven years later, her story turned into the brightly animated and wistfully told coming-of-age fantasy The Cat Returns. Though The Cat Returns is not at the same level as Miyazaki and Takahata’s works, even a minor Studio Ghibli release is heads and shoulders above the competition.

Shy high school student Haru has long had the uncanny ability to communicate with cats. One day, she rescues a strange cat from oncoming traffic. But the cat turns out to be no ordinary feline. He is actually Prince of the Cat Kingdom and to repay Haru’s kindness, he offers to take her hand in marriage! To clear up the mix-up, Haru travels to the Cat Kingdom with the help of Baron. But once she steps into the land of the cats, she discovers that she herself is gradually turning into a cat!.
